About This Item

Hurst and Company, circa 1900. Good. This brown rawhide leather book is comprised of 223 pages and the cover is engraved with penmanship and a lightly painted fireplace scene. First published in 1883, this is a collection of poems by Henry Wadsworth Longfellow, depicting a group of people staying at the Wayside Inn in Massachusetts and was published by Hurst & Company. Condition: Good. Wear to corners, side, and chipping on spine. water damage present as well ad slight burn to right half of front cover
